NE10 Men's Lacrosse Report: Week 5

NE10 Men's Lacrosse Report: Week 5

Week 5 - April 19, 2021

NE10 Player of the Week

Nicolas Racalbuto, Adelphi
Graduate Student | Attack | Merrick, N.Y.

In a 1-1 week for Adelphi men's lacrosse, Nico Racalbuto finished with a team-high nine points courtesy of eight goals and one assist. Despite the overtime loss at #1 Le Moyne, he recorded five tallies with a perfect shot-on-goal percentage. He was responsible for a hat trick later in the week in a 14-9 win against Pace.


NE10 Goalkeeper of the Week

CJ Hart, Saint Anselm
Senior | Goalkeeper | Reading, Mass.

Across two games this past week, Hart helped the Hawks extend its program-record winning streak to 11 games with 24 saves and a .750 save percentage. Against Saint Michael's, he made nine saves on 11 shots before making 15 saves against Franklin Pierce on Apr. 17. He ranks first in NCAA Division II with a 5.21 goals-against average and a .625 save percentage.


NE10 Rookie of the Week

Anthony Caputo, Pace
Sophomore | Midfield | Westbury, N.Y.

Caputo started the week with an impressive four points on three goals and one assist in a 15-3 victory over Saint Rose on Wednesday. He then added two goals in a tough loss to No. 6 Adelphi.


NE10 Weekly Honor Roll

Ryan Erler, Adelphi (Jr., GK, Smithtown, N.Y.)
In a 1-1 week for Adelphi men's lacrosse Ryan Erler stepped up in a 14-9 win over Pace University, facing 48 shots and recording a career-high 15 saves. For the contest he posted a 62.5 save percentage, allowing just nine goals. For the week he finished with 16 saves overall, after registering a few minutes in the OT loss at #1 Le Moyne.

Kristopher Campbell, Bentley (Sr., A, Longmeadow, Mass.)
Had a team high 6 goals and 8 points on the week in two games. Scored four goals and had 1 assist in Bentley's 9-7 win over Southern New Hampshire on April 14. Had two goals and one assist in Bentley's near upset of No. 1 Le Moyne on Saturday.

Keaton Roarick, Bentley (Jr., GK, Old Saybrook, Conn.)
Roarick had a 64.0 save percentage and 8.84 GAA for the week. He made 20 saves and had a 63.2 save percentage as Bentley nearly upset No. 1 ranked Le Moyne before falling in overtime 11-10. He made 14 saves in the 2nd half and overtime. Roarick made 12 saves and had a 63.2 save percentage in Bentley's 9-7 win over Southern NH on April 14.

Josh Dorr, Franklin Pierce (Sr., M, Brunswick, Maine)
Josh Dorr started and played in two games for the Ravens this past week helping his squad to a 1-1 record. He totaled five goals, one assist for six points with one caused turnover and one groundball. In the 10-9 comeback win at Assumption Dorr racked up three goals in the victory. He followed that up with two goals and one assist in the in the setback to nationally-ranked Saint Anselm.

Jake Nelson, Le Moyne (Sr., A, Charlotte, N.C.)
He recorded six points on three goals, including a game-winner, and three assists in top-ranked Le Moyne's 2-0 week. He opened the week with four points on two goals and two assists in a 15-14 double-overtime win over sixth-ranked Adelphi on Wednesday. He then scored the game-winning goal with 51 seconds left in overtime to give the Dolphins an 11-10 win at Bentley on Saturday, while also adding an assist.

Dan Lewis, Pace (Gr., D, Bohemia, N.Y.)
Lewis was once again creating havoc for the Setters' defense during a 1-1 stretch last week. The graduate student put together 10 ground balls and five caused turnovers. Lewis' defense allowed just three goals in a mid-week win at Saint Rose, signifying the lowest total given up for Pace since 2012.

Louis Ragusa, Pace (Jr., GK, Yorktown Height, N.Y.)
Ragusa totaled 28 saves in a 1-1 stretch for Pace last week. After allowing just three goals in a mid-week win at Saint Rose, the junior posted a season-high 16 stops at No. 6 Adelphi on Saturday. Ragusa currently ranks third in the NE10 in total saves this season with 98 in nine games.

Jack Andrews, Saint Anselm (So., M, Cumberland, R.I.)
Robinson led the Hawks with six goals and four assists for 10 points (6-4=10) this past week, helping Saint Anselm extend its program-record winning streak to 11 games. He also added 10 ground balls, tying for the team lead, and scored on six of his seven shots on frame. His two man-up goals also led the Hawks in the two-game winning streak.

Max Katavolos, Saint Michael's (So., A, Newburyport, Mass.)
Sophomore Max Katavolos (Newburyport, Mass.) scored seven goals against 14th-ranked Saint Anselm and Assumption, which was receiving national votes, last week. In an 18-3 loss to the Hawks, he scored once while adding two ground balls before scoring six times with two more ground balls in a 17-14 defeat versus Assumption on Saturday. Four of his seven strikes were with a man up.

Oscar Kozikowski, Southern N.H. (Sr., GK, Portsmouth, N.H.)
Earned his second win of the season by making 10 saves in SNHU's win 15-5 over AIC on Saturday at Penmen Stadium.

David Wiedenfeld, Southern N.H. (Gr., A, Londonderry, N.H.)
David Wiedenfeld had a nine point week for the Penmen, including a fourth quarter hat trick as the Penmen turned back AIC on Saturday at Penmen Stadium. He also collected 13 ground balls.
